Linus Ekenstam said it "broke his brain" — work that took hours in After Effects now takes minutes. +> +> **It generates code, not pixels** — Unlike other AI video tools, Vibe Motion produces actual animation code (via Remotion under the hood), not hallucinated video. Text never breaks, edits stay consistent, and you get a controllable, editable asset, per @Totinhiiio. +> +> **Honest reviews: promising but not polished yet** — Chase Jarvis found results "okay" but noted 5+ minute render times, credit burn on iteration (8-60 credits per gen, $9 plan = ~150 credits), and that basic results are achievable faster with Canva. His verdict: "not quite ready for prime time" but the underlying tech shows significant potential. + +**Key patterns discovered:** +1. Describe structure, not effects — Focus on timing, hierarchy, typography, and flow rather than expressive visual storytelling, per Higgsfield's official guide +2. Upload your actual assets first — Brand logos, product images, PDFs give the AI context to build around YOUR files, not generic placeholders +3. Use presets as starting points — Select a format (Infographics, Text Animation, Posters) before writing your prompt +4. Keep prompts conversational and direct — Short commands > long descriptions. "Create a kinetic typography intro" beats a paragraph of specs, per Segmind +5. Budget for iteration — Each generation burns credits, so get your prompt right before hitting generate, per Chase Jarvis + +**Research Stats:** 10 Reddit threads + 30 X posts from @rezkhere, @Hartdrawss, @Totinhiiio + 14 web pages (Higgsfield blog, Chase Jarvis, SiliconANGLE, Segmind) + +**Follow-up suggestions offered:** +> I'm now an expert on Higgsfield Vibe Motion prompting.
